On the existence of bounded solutions for a nonlinear elliptic system

Abstract

This work deals with the system (Δ)mu=a(x)vp(-\Delta)^m u= a(x) v^p, (Δ)mv=b(x)uq(-\Delta)^m v=b(x) u^q with Dirichlet boundary condition in a domain Ω\RRn\Omega\subset\RR^n, where Ω\Omega is a ball if n3n\ge 3 or a smooth perturbation of a ball when n=2n=2. We prove that, under appropriate conditions on the parameters (a,b,p,q,m,na,b,p,q,m,n), any non-negative solution (u,v)(u,v) of the system is bounded by a constant independent of (u,v)(u,v). Moreover, we prove that the conditions are sharp in the sense that, up to some border case, the relation on the parameters are also necessary. The case m=1m=1 was considered by Souplet in \cite{PS}. Our paper generalize to m1m\ge 1 the results of that paper.
